When to Winterize Your Boat in Sioux City, IA
Freeze protection for a Sioux City boat keys off the first 28°F freeze, which averages October 18, so haul out and winterize by October 11 to beat it. Year to year the date swings about 28 days, which is why the live outlook beats the calendar.

Local freeze dates for Sioux City
| Threshold | Early (1-in-10) | Median | Late (9-in-10)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 32°F (light freeze) | Sep 24 | Oct 7 | Oct 21 |
| 28°F (hard freeze) | Oct 2 | Oct 18 | Oct 30 |
| 24°F (severe) | Oct 14 | Oct 27 | Nov 9 |
NOAA station: Sioux City Ang · 7.2 mi away · 1,100 ft elevation.
- A mid-fall first freeze gives Sioux City a moderate window; a warm October does not mean the deadline moved.
The reference station for Sioux City is Sioux City Ang (7.2 mi, 1,100 ft). First freeze there: 32°F by Oct 7, 28°F by Oct 18, 24°F by Oct 27. Year to year the 28°F date has ranged from Oct 2 to Oct 30 — about 28 days apart. Spring's last 32°F freeze clears around Apr 29. Snowfall averages 36 inches a year, first reaching an inch near November.
The freeze arrives in two steps in Sioux City: 32°F around Oct 7, then a hard 28°F near Oct 18. Year to year, the first 32°F night has fallen anywhere from Sep 24 to Oct 21 — about 27 days apart. Spring's final freeze lands near Apr 29 and as late as May 11, so that is when outdoor water and stored gear can safely come back online. Your boat checklist
- Change the engine oil and filter while the motor is warm so contaminants leave with the old oil.

- Drain the raw-water system, the livewell, and any washdown lines that can trap water.

- Support the cover so snow and rain shed off, and leave vents so the interior can breathe.
- For an inboard or sterndrive, follow the manual closely — those blocks are the ones freeze claims hit hardest.

What this means locally
Compared with nearby cities, Sioux City's first-freeze date near Oct 18 sits about a week ahead of Sioux Falls (Oct 24) and about a week ahead of Omaha (Oct 30). Iowa's deadlines span Oct 11 to Oct 25 statewide — one date for all of Iowa would be off by weeks for Sioux City.
